DOJ Issues Subpoenas to Bank of America Amid Discrimination Investigation and Potential Regulatory Changes

The U.S. Department of Justice has launched an investigation into Bank of America (NYSE:BAC), issuing subpoenas to determine if there has been any politically motivated discrimination in the closure of customer accounts. This inquiry is raising important questions about how certain groups of customers may have faced discriminatory practices based on their political affiliations or activities.

As this investigation unfolds, it coincides with ongoing discussions among policymakers regarding potentially reclassifying Bank of America under a higher community bank threshold, which could reach up to $30 billion. Such a reclassification would likely subject the bank to stricter regulatory scrutiny, influencing its operational framework.

For investors, this development places legal and regulatory risks front and center for one of the nation’s largest consumer and commercial banks. Operating across various financial sectors—including retail banking, credit cards, small business lending, and capital markets—any changes in oversight could significantly affect Bank of America’s compliance strategies and operational efficiencies.

As policymakers continue to debate bank classification and customer account treatment, the implications of these discussions remain uncertain. Analysts are closely monitoring how potential changes could alter Bank of America’s costs, product offerings, and overall brand perception among customers and regulators.

In terms of financial health, Bank of America’s stock is currently trading at about $56.02, approximately 11% below the analyst target of $63.16. With a fair value estimate suggesting shares are trading at a 19.2% discount, the current valuation invites scrutiny. Recent performance has seen the stock rise by 12.4% over the past month, indicating a strong short-term momentum.

Investors should take note of several key considerations moving forward:
– The DOJ subpoenas and the potential for increased oversight may directly influence Bank of America’s operational costs and compliance procedures.
– Attention should be directed toward disclosures regarding the bank’s account closure practices and any changes to compliance spending resulting from tighter regulations.
– The heightened risk of significant insider selling over the past three months is particularly relevant in the context of the ongoing investigations.
